Ernest McKAY

Regimental number1200
Date of birth17 May 1894
Place of birthBowen Bridge Road, Brisbane, Queensland
SchoolSt James (Catholic) School Valley, Queensland
ReligionRoman Catholic
OccupationCarpenter
AddressBowen Bridge, Brisbane, Queensland
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ation20
Next of kinFather, Ernest McKay, Bowen Bridge, Brisbane, Queensland
Enlistment date13 April 1915
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name11th Light Horse Regiment, 6th Reinforcement
AWM Embarkation Roll number10/16/2
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Sydney, New South Wales, on board HMAT A47 Mashobra on 4 October 1915
Other details from Roll of Honour CircularOne of the most popular boys in his regiment. Also a good footballer, in fact, one of the best all round players in Eygpt.
FateKilled in Action 25 September 1918
Place of death or woundingPalestine, Eygpt
Age at death23.5
Age at death from cemetery records23
Place of burialHaifa War Cemetery (Row B, Grave No. 52), Palestine
